Roe makes three changes to Wexford NFL side
Wexford football boss Pat Roe has made three changes from the side that scored a facile win over Limerick last time out for Sunday's National Football League clash with bottom-of-the-table Sligo at Markievicz Park.
U21 goalkeeper Anthony Masterson is set to make his senior debut, replacing John Cooper, while Nicky Lambert is chosen ahead of Brendan Doyle.
Kieran Kennedy deputises for Redmond Barry, who is set to line out with the county hurlers on the same day.
WEXFORD (SF v Sligo): A Masterson; C Morris, P Wallace, N Murphy; R Mageean, D Murphy, S Cullen; D Kinsella, N Lambert; K Kennedy, P Colfer, J Hegarty; D Fogarty, J Hudson, M Forde.
